Online self-paced learning modules. The Centre for Clinical Interventions (CCI) has developed a number of these resources which are freely available to the public (see disclaimer below). Each module includes information, worksheets, and suggested exercises or activities. It is recommended that you complete each module before going on to the next, although not essential.
- Back from the Bluez Coping with Depression: This is designed to provide you with some information about depression and suggested strategies for how you can manage your low mood.

- Keeping Your Balance Coping with Bipolar Disorder: information about bipolar disorder and suggested strategies for how you can manage your mood.
-
Assert Yourself Designed to help you develop important communication skills which can reduce your levels of depression and anxiety and increase your self esteem.
- Shy No Longer Coping with Social Anxiety is designed to provide information about social anxiety and suggested strategies for managing your anxiety in social situations.
- Panic Stations Coping with Panic Attacks: provides you with some information about panic attacks and panic disorder and suggested strategies for how you can manage your panic and anxiety.
- What? Me Worry!?! Mastering Your Worries: Information about chronic worrying and generalised anxiety disorder and suggested strategies for how you can manage your worrying and anxiety.
- Improving Self-Esteem Overcoming Low Self-Esteem: Information about low self-esteem - how it develops, is maintained, and how to address this problem.
- Put Off Procrastination! Overcoming Procrastination: Information and some suggested strategies to address procrastination.
